Spicy Jalapeno Rice

A spicy Mexican-style rice without tomatoes.

Ready In: 40 mins

Serves: 4

Directions

  1. In a large saucepan heat the oil on medium-high heat. Saute onions until golden brown. About a minute before completing the onions, add garlic and jalapenos; saute another minute.
  2. Add in uncooked rice, broth, cumin, salt and pepper; bring to a boil. Reduce the heat and cover the saucepan. Simmer on low heat for 20-25 minutes or until liquid is gone and rice is tender and fluffy. Remove from heat. The longer you leave on the lid, the fluffier the rice will become. Add minced cilantro and stir gently.
  3. Top each serving with cheese, if desired.
